m2e and mahout problem

Hi,

I checked out latest mahout project from truck, successfully built it in
maven. But I am not able to import the project to eclipse. I got error
message:
Cannot parse lifecycle mapping metadata for maven project MavenProject:
org.apache.mahout:mahour:0.8-SNAPSHOT @ ... Cause: Unrecognized tag:
'version' (position: START_TAG seen ... </artifactid>\n    <version>...
@8:18 )

I am using eclipse JUNO and m2e 1.2. Any help is appreciated.
